Yield: Serves 4
Ingredients:
1 medium onion, small dice
2 tsp fresh ginger paste (grocery store produce section)
2 cloves minced garlic
1 tbsp Italian herb paste
Salt and pepper to taste (or Nature's Seasoning blend)
4 cups low sodium chicken broth
2 cups frozen California mix veg (or veggies of your choice)
1 cup dry pasta
1 large chicken breast, thawed, diced
1 tbsp garlic olive oil (or regular)
Instructions:
Heat olive oil in a pot on medium-high heat, sweat onions and garlic until translucent, add herbs and seasonings at this point. Add chicken and cook through. Add veggies and broth, bring to a boil before adding noodles. Turn temperature down to medium and let noodles cook. Serve once noodles and veggies are cooked/heated through.
